Created attachment 191261 [details] Patch for public key auth scheme See https://wiki.strongswan.org/issues/2579 An issue existed with how the compiler optimise some code and caused a crash in the public key authentication of certificates.
Committed, thanks!
A commit references this bug: Author: yuri Date: Tue Mar 6 21:56:49 UTC 2018 New revision: 463768 URL: https://svnweb.freebsd.org/changeset/ports/463768 Log: security/strongswan: Fix crash in public key authentication with 5.6.2 While here, added LICENSE_FILE. PR: 226404 Submitted by: strongswan@Nanoteq.com (maintainer) Approved by: tcberner (mentor, implicit) Changes: head/security/strongswan/Makefile head/security/strongswan/files/patch-src_libcharon_sa_ikev2_authenticators_pubkey_authenticator.c
Please merge it to 2018Q1 branch since the upgrade from 5.6.0 -> 5.6.2 was committed there too
A commit references this bug: Author: yuri Date: Sun Mar 11 08:49:07 UTC 2018 New revision: 464151 URL: https://svnweb.freebsd.org/changeset/ports/464151 Log: MFH: r463768 security/strongswan: Fix crash in public key authentication with 5.6.2 While here, added LICENSE_FILE. PR: 226404 Submitted by: strongswan@Nanoteq.com (maintainer) Approved by: tcberner (mentor, implicit) Approved by: ports-secteam (lists@eitanadler.com) Changes: _U branches/2018Q1/ branches/2018Q1/security/strongswan/Makefile branches/2018Q1/security/strongswan/files/patch-src_libcharon_sa_ikev2_authenticators_pubkey_authenticator.c